Allie Zenwirth

Allie Zenwirth has had a laundry list of jobs: dorm room painter, barback, lighting designer, amateur dancer, bathroom monitor, cashier, house manager, waitress and others. She served as an in-person covid contact tracer, worked in refugee resettlement, and as an early employee of Missouri’s statewide public defenders’ holistic services division. In law school, she served as a researcher for Decarcerate KC, a summer intern with ArchCity Defenders, and an on and off-season intern with Rights Behind Bars, as a student in UCLA School of Law’s appellate Prisoners’ Rights Clinic, and as a full-time extern for Justice Montoya-Lewis of the Washington State Supreme Court.
